2010 AUD to LTL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2010

During 2010, the AUD to LTL ex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 29, valuing the pair at 2.6684.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 3, dropping to 2.1620.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.5065 LTL.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2.2054 to the December average rate of 2.5955, the exchange rate registered a net change of 17.69%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 2.2299 2.1620 2.2054
February 2.2878 2.1691 2.2402
March 2.3549 2.2760 2.3208
April 2.4179 2.3553 2.3835
May 2.4638 2.2906 2.3886
June 2.4659 2.3566 2.4135
July 2.4178 2.3125 2.3693
August 2.4322 2.3843 2.4114
September 2.5256 2.4459 2.4793
October 2.4611 2.4213 2.4379
November 2.5477 2.4467 2.4987
December 2.6684 2.5448 2.5955
